Description en: Genus of 4 species of prostrate perennials found in moist sites at mid-to high altitudes in Australia, New Zealand, and South America. They are cultivated for their alternate, variably shaped, entire or toothed, mid- to dark green leaves, and their tubular, 5-lobed flowers. They are suitable for a large rock garden, but are too invasive for a small area.
Hardiness en: Fully hardy to frost hardy.
Cultivation en:
Propagation en: Sow seed at 6-12°C (43-54°F), or divide, in spring.
Pests en: Slugs and snails may be a problem.
